And it's a boy for Today co-anchor, Dylan Dreyer and her meteorologist husband, Brian Fichera. Dreyer and Fichera welcomed their baby (now named Oliver George Fichera) on Thursday morning, the Today show announced.

Fichera also confirmed that both Dyl (Dylan) and Ollie (Oliver) are doing 'fantastic.' The little one now joins their son, Calvin Fichera, 3, in the family. This arrival news comes shortly after Dreyer's Today co-hosts threw her an on-air baby "sprinkle" shower to celebrate. "I feel like I'm in the final stretch," Dreyer told her co-hosts during the December celebration, sharing that her due date was Jan. 8.

Dreyer was then surprised by "special guests" at the on-air shower: her husband and son! She then teared up as videos from family members played, wishing her well on her last weeks of pregnancy.

Dreyer first announced her pregnancy in July, sharing the news on Today. She also revealed at the time that she'd be welcoming a baby boy.

The pregnancy announcement came about three months after Dreyer had opened up about suffering a miscarriage. "We got really lucky with Calvin," Dreyer shared in April 2018. "We tried maybe one or two months."

"Nine months ago, we decided that we really wanted to have another baby," she shared. "I went to my OBGYN and I just said, 'We've been trying for about six months, and I don't really know what's going on. But my cycles are all over the place.'"
